Transaction 916017f604ffe245ccdd482a23a6ab0812988fed65ccb5a514d8568735dd3fc8
1 Input
2 Outputs
- 916017f604ffe245ccdd482a23a6ab0812988fed65ccb5a514d8568735dd3fc8:0
- 916017f604ffe245ccdd482a23a6ab0812988fed65ccb5a514d8568735dd3fc8:1
value 187359010
address 13fVNrh2MBXPzwesh9Y8thdFpksZBvRRZR
value 543834148
address 38zLK8T5Ys3T7UZJxjCZn1i18fdP4d22oo